Check NowNEW DELHI: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) will conduct the Class 10 term 2 Science exam tomorrow, May 10, 2022. The CBSE 10th Science exam 2022 term 2 will start at 10:30 am. Students will get 2 hours to solve the paper. The CBSE Class 10 term 2 Science exam will be of 40 marks.

Students appearing in the 10th Science exam should now practice with the CBSE sample question papers, go through the entire syllabus and have a final look before appearing in the examination.
CBSE board has released the term 2 syllabus and sample question paper separately. Students can download the same through the official website of CBSE, cbseacademic.nic.in.
How to download CBSE 10th Science sample papers 2022
-
Visit the official website cbseacademic.nic.in.
-
On the home page, click on the sample question papers followed by ‘SQP 2021-22’
-
Now select Class X. A list with subject names will appear on the screen.
-
Now select Science SQP.
-
The sample paper for Science will get displayed on the screen.
-
Download the sample paper and practice.
